Cleaning these door handles periodically could reduce this cross-contamination risk. The sustained effect following cleaning with chlorhexidine could be beneficial in restroom facilities as cleaning episodes are of necessity at time intervals. The cleaning efficacies and residual effects of Sani Cloth CHG 2% wipes were investigated in a double-blinded randomized crossover controlled trial in a school setting. No significant difference occurred in initial cleaning efficacy; however, following a six-hour period of use by pupils of the restroom facilities, the internal door handles wiped with Sani-Cloth CHG 2% wipes were significantly less contaminated than those with the control wipe (14% v. 32%, p = .02).
